Transaction 511d5833d924385684f803195e777e9d09d508097a26f64cc5fcd34a09d8eed5
1 Input
1 Output
-
511d5833d924385684f803195e777e9d09d508097a26f64cc5fcd34a09d8eed5:0
- value
- 34981136
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b3f40fb4e6e0d57e14563c1948791d6caf6a4fc OP_EQUALVERIFY OP_CHECKSIG
- address
- 19KUGQnQ6n1u3tokwAmZsCTSknVzMx7Hhy